Post by professorhoya on Jul 10, 2021 16:12:23 GMT -5
Are the combines invite only? Yes that is correct. NBA teams get to vote for the players they want to attend combine and G League Camp. I believe each team votes for something like 70 players and then those votes are tallied and make up the players that are invited. Maybe professor is referring to something else but for combine and G League a player cannot just show up as far as I am aware, it requires an invite. Usually with things like the Portsmouth combine, I believe it's pretty easy to get an invite. If you're a borderline or unknown candidate then doing well at Portsmouth will get you into the NBA combine. (This was the Scottie Pippen route). IIRC, Austin Freeman turned down the Portsmouth invite thinking he would be an automatic bid to the NBA combine but was never invited to the NBA combine either so kind of shot himself in the foot. This year the Portsmouth combine was cancelled due to the Pandemic (which has state based restrictions). So the Tampa combine was created to fill one of the gaps. Javhon and Bile participated in that one but Jamorko did not. The G League Elite was another new combine and that one has a direct conduit to the NBA since the NBA owns the G League. "A select number of players from the NBA G League Elite Camp will be invited to participate in the 2021 NBA Draft Combine based on their performance"
